Overview of Lithium Metal

Lithium Metal is a soft, silvery-white alkali metal widely used in industrial, chemical, and energy applications. Known for its high electrochemical potential and lightweight properties, Lithium Metal is supplied in ingots, sheets, or foil under an inert atmosphere or oil to prevent oxidation and ensure safe handling.

In industrial and laboratory applications, Lithium Metal is essential for battery production, chemical synthesis, metallurgical processes, and speciality alloy manufacturing. Safety & Handling Guidelines

  • Store Lithium Metal in a cool, dry place under an inert atmosphere or oil

  • Avoid contact with water, moisture, or acids to prevent violent reactions

  • Wear gloves, goggles, and protective clothing during handling

  • Follow all MSDS and industrial safety protocols

  • Handle with caution to avoid sparks and reactive incidents
